Understanding Eco-Friendly Blow Molders What is a Blow Molder? A blow molder is a specialized machine used to manufacture hollow plastic parts and containers by inflating a heated plastic tube (parison) inside a mold until it takes the shape of the cavity. This technique is widely used for producing bottles, drums, and other packaging components. Traditionally, blow molding has been associated with high energy consumption and plastic waste, but recent advancements are reversing these trends. Facilitating the Use of Recycled Content Leshan’s blow molders are engineered to process a wide variety of recycled plastics, including PET, HDPE, and PP. The machines’ robust screw and barrel designs ensure consistent melting and extrusion of recycled resins, overcoming challenges such as material variability and contamination. This capability empowers packaging manufacturers to increase their use of recycled content, directly reducing the demand for virgin plastics and contributing to global recycling targets. Supporting Lightweighting Initiatives Lightweighting is a critical trend in sustainable packaging, focused on reducing material usage without compromising the performance or integrity of containers. Leshan’s precise parison control systems enable manufacturers to produce thinner-walled bottles and containers, optimizing material use and lowering transportation costs due to reduced weight. This approach not only conserves resources but also reduces greenhouse gas emissions throughout the supply chain. Understanding Industrial EBM Technology Extrusion Blow Molding (EBM) is a versatile process used in manufacturing hollow plastic products, including bottles, jerry cans, drums, and specialty containers. At its core, EBM involves melting plastic resin, extruding a parison (tube), and shaping it within a mold through compressed air. For high-volume producers, machine reliability, speed, and precision are crucial for maintaining throughput while minimizing defects and downtime. Material Flexibility for Diverse Applications The ability to process various resins—including HDPE, LDPE, PP, PETG, and PVC—gives manufacturers a competitive edge. Leshan’s screw and barrel designs ensure optimal plastication for different materials, while multi-layer co-extrusion capabilities enable the production of sophisticated containers with barrier or aesthetic layers. This flexibility supports a wide range of industries, from food and beverage packaging to industrial chemicals. Quality Assurance at High Speeds Maintaining product quality at high output rates is a persistent challenge. Leshan incorporates real-time vision systems and non-contact measurement technologies to inspect wall thickness, surface defects, and dimensional accuracy as each part leaves the mold. Rejects are automatically separated from the production line, ensuring only conforming products reach customers and reducing the need for manual intervention.
